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2354 438 744270
10497 82684 93519227
10497 82684 93519227
227694397 5941584598 72 5832574 4952
All about undefined
Interested in learning more?
10497 82684 93519227
227694397 5941584598 72 5832574 4952
See more
742920637 05122
432199136 071 4752846315
See more
9905800394 610
1384069 53 703
See more